About Adobe Systems (ADBE)

Adobe Systems is a leading software company known for its innovative creative and digital marketing solutions. The company specializes in products that empower individuals and businesses to produce high-quality digital content, including graphic design, video editing, web development, and document management. Its flagship offerings, such as Adobe Photoshop, Illustrator, and Adobe Acrobat, are widely used by professionals across various industries. Additionally, Adobe provides cloud-based services that enhance collaboration and streamline workflows, helping users create, manage, and optimize their digital assets effectively. Adobe’s New Productivity Agent Redefines How People Understand, Create and Share Information
Adobe (Nasdaq:ADBE) – the global technology leader that unleashes creativity, productivity and customer experiences through innovative tools and platforms – unveiled Adobe's productivity agent, which brings decades of Acrobat document intelligence into a single agentic interface to transform how people understand, create and share information. The agent orchestrates tools and models to generate images, text and rich content like presentations, podcasts and social posts and power conversational PDF editing in Acrobat. It also unlocks the new sharing and publishing capabilities in PDF Spaces, an AI-powered workspace where you can combine files, links and notes to do research, get insights and create content.

Alluvium and Adobe Partner to Advance Supply and Demand Intelligence for Health Systems
Alluvium, a leader in enterprise access and capacity performance for health systems, today announced a collaboration with Adobe to bring next-level intelligence to healthcare capacity management. By fusing Alluvium’s supply orchestration expertise with the demand generation power of the Adobe Experience Platform, the joint solution will help provider organizations close the loop between supply and demand while unlocking rich market insights and ROI.

Adobe Completes Semrush Acquisition, Strengthening CX Enterprise with Enhanced Brand Visibility Capabilities
Adobe (Nasdaq:ADBE) — the global technology leader that unleashes creativity, productivity and customer experiences through innovative tools and platforms — today announced the completion of its acquisition of Semrush Holdings, Inc., a leading brand visibility platform, enhancing its ability to offer businesses more capabilities to drive discoverability and conversion as AI interfaces and agents become a primary way for customers to discover, evaluate and engage brands.
